Spokes, Scotland’s leading cycle campaign group which covers Edinburgh and the wider Lothian area, has announced that it is to stop publicising events that require participants to wear a helmet in the face of what it describes as
“the creeping growth of semi-compulsion.” The group’s stance regarding making helmets mandatory is in line with that of the
Royal Society for the Prevention of Accidents (RosPA), which says it is impractical to make use of helmets compulsory.
